What is Biodiesel?
Biodiesel is a renewable, biodegradable fuel produced from various feedstocks such as vegetable oils, animal fats, and used cooking oil through a chemical process known as transesterification. The result is Fatty Acid Methyl Esters (FAME), which can replace or blend with traditional diesel fuels.
Common blends in Europe include B7 (7% biodiesel) and B20 (20% biodiesel), with B100 representing pure biodiesel. The fuel can be used across multiple sectors including transportation, industrial heating, and power generation.
Key Market Drivers
- Renewable Energy Mandates by the European Union
Under the Renewable Energy Directive (RED II), the EU mandates that 14% of transport fuel must be derived from renewable sources by 2030. Biodiesel plays a pivotal role in achieving this target. The directive also includes sustainability criteria that promote the use of advanced biofuels and waste-based biodiesel, creating strong tailwinds for market expansion.
- Focus on Sustainability and Carbon Reduction
As Europe intensifies its commitment to the Paris Agreement and Net Zero goals, biodiesel emerges as a crucial tool to lower greenhouse gas (GHG) emissions. The shift to biodiesel helps decarbonize high-emission sectors like transportation and logistics, while also supporting circular economies through the reuse of waste fats and oils.
- Technological Innovations
Significant advancements have enhanced biodiesel conversion technologies, reducing operational costs and improving scalability. For instance, Argent Energy’s facility in Amsterdam, launched in October 2024, converts crude glycerin (a biodiesel byproduct) into 99.7% pure, technical-grade glycerin — a step toward valorizing waste and improving profitability.
Market Challenges
- Feedstock Supply Constraints
The market faces supply chain disruptions due to seasonal agricultural volatility, geopolitical tensions, and rising competition for vegetable oils and animal fats. These limitations make feedstock sourcing unpredictable and increase production costs.
- Price Competitiveness and Rising Alternatives
While biodiesel is a greener fuel, it remains costlier than petroleum-based diesel. The rise of green hydrogen, e-fuels, and electric mobility also presents strong competition, potentially hindering long-term adoption of biodiesel in certain applications.

Segment Analysis
By Application
- Fuel: The largest segment, dominated by use in transportation. Biodiesel reduces emissions from passenger vehicles, buses, and freight transport.
- Power Generation: Growing demand for low-emission backup and off-grid power systems is boosting biodiesel-based generator installations.
- Others: Includes uses in industrial heating, marine applications, and agriculture machinery.
By Feedstock
- Vegetable Oil: Includes rapeseed, soybean, palm, and sunflower oils. Rapeseed oil remains the most utilized in Europe due to its favorable cold-flow properties and local availability.
- Animal Fats: Used in waste-based biodiesel, gaining traction due to its sustainability credentials and ability to meet RED II advanced biofuel targets.
Country-Level Market Insights
🇬🇧 United Kingdom
The UK market is witnessing fast-paced growth due to strong government decarbonization targets, widespread EV-biodiesel hybrid models, and rising industrial adoption. Incentives such as the Renewable Transport Fuel Obligation (RTFO) are key growth enablers.
🇩🇪 Germany
Germany remains Europe’s biodiesel frontrunner. With stringent emissions norms and active support from the Federal Environment Agency, Germany is leveraging biodiesel for both domestic consumption and exports. The use of second-generation biodiesel is rising in urban transport systems.
🇫🇷 France
France’s push toward climate neutrality has led to increased biodiesel usage in public transportation and agricultural sectors. Strong policy support and local production of feedstock, particularly sunflower oil, drive the market.
🇪🇸 Spain
Spain is aggressively diversifying its energy mix. The government’s green policies and investments in waste-to-biodiesel plants are propelling biodiesel as a clean energy substitute for fossil fuels in commercial transport and logistics.
🇮🇹 Italy
Italy’s biodiesel industry is expanding due to increasing consumer awareness and the growth of bio-refineries across the country. As part of its 2030 National Energy and Climate Plan (NECP), Italy aims to enhance biofuel contributions to reduce carbon intensity.
